对于动态生成的页面或者网页插件,怎样让ie7,8支持css3的圆角,阴影?

发布于 2022-08-25 11:09:33 字数 386 浏览 12 评论 0

我尝试过使用PIE.htc来解决ie7,8对css3特性的支持问题,但针对于本地的html页面是可行的,放到服务器上,
就失效了。目前应用到圆角的有两个地方,一个是网页插件,一个是服务器端动态生成的html页面。

根据网上的说法,PIE.htc的引用路径虽然写在css里,但只能相对于调用它的html文档来设置,尝试了以下几种办法:
1.相对于该html文件处开始算路径;js/PIE.htc,对于插件不可行,因为调用插件的页面都是外部的,没有办法确定相对于html的路径。
2.使用绝对路径,例如:http://xxx/PIE.htc,也不可行。

网上提到的提供正确的Content-Type,服务器端也不存在这个问题。

求大神指教,有什么比较好的实用的方法来解决这个问题,不胜感激!

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(2

禾厶谷欠 2022-09-01 11:09:33

.htc这些东西都受到安全策略的限制,不能保证可用。

如果你想支持IE7,就生成带有圆角的图片。
不然还是赶紧投奔IE9。

溺渁∝ 2022-09-01 11:09:33

你可能需要这个。
http://www.malsup.com/jquery/corner/

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文